Default Cheep gas tank strap fix

Hello everyone just fixed that hanging gas tank.
The strap on one side was hanging, bolts was broke. Went to Home Depot and bought a 8 1/4 inch clothes line hook for $2.00 works perfectly. Would post a picture if I knew how.
